VISALIA – The postseason honors continue to roll in after an impressive 2025 Coalinga College football season.
On Friday, six members from the Falcons squad were named First-Team All-State Region II by the California Community College Football Coaches Association (3CFCA). The selections were announced at the state coaches' postseason meeting in Visalia.
Earning all-state honors for the Falcons were:
Demarion Wright, So., RB
Khalif Bloome, So., WR
David Dunn, Fr., WR
Donovan Urbina, So., OL
Gavin Brady, So., LB
Jackson Kissee, So., DB
"They are all super deserving of the award.," said Coalinga head coach Justin Berna. "I'm really proud of this group."
According to Berna, the six all-state selections were the most since he took over the program in 2017.
The accolades come after the Falcons wrapped up the season by qualifying for their third bowl game in four seasons, finished in second place in the American Golden Coast League with a 4-1 record, and earned their fourth straight winning season with a 7-4 overall mark.
